| Description: | Duke of Marlborough weds Miss Gladys Deacon, who wore a wonderful dress of gold tissue and priceless lace. Paris, France. Gladys and the Duke, John Albert Spencer Churchill, stand at the bottom of the steps, she is helped by an attendant. They pose together and she gives her flowers to another woman. She then puts her parasol up and takes the flowers back. The couple walk off and the attendants pick up her train. She is wearig a beautiful 1920s style wedding gown, a full veil & a very long train. | |
